Instagram’s journey was predictable. The company started as a photo sharing service and quickly adopted the latest trends in the core app. First it brought video upload support, then the Instagram direct message came. Later, Instagram took a page from the Snapchat book and put Instagram Stories on the app. Now, the Facebook-owned company is getting on the TikTok train with Instagram Reels, a 15-second video function with music, live filters, and all the fun stuff. At times, it gets confusing for users to choose between Instagram Story and Reels.
Both Instagram Story and Reels are integrated into the same interface. From the main interface you can swipe right and open the viewfinder menu with Story, Live and Reels options.

Where is Instagram Story and Reels
Both Instagram Reels and Story are in the same interface. You can swipe right or tap on the story option in the upper left corner to open the camera interface on Instagram.

By default, Instagram opens the Story interface and encourages users to choose Instagram Story. Swipe left to open Instagram Live and Swipe Right to go to Instagram Reels.
Key Differences
Instagram defines Stories as something that lets you ‘share all the moments of your day, not just what you want to keep on your profile’. This feature allows you to share multiple photos and videos, and they appear together in a slideshow format, which means a reel like Snapchat. And of course these photos and videos will disappear after 24 hours.

Instagram Reels is a content format that lets you create and share 15-second videos with others in a new custom Feed on the Discover page. Much like TikTok, Instagram Reels gives you a set of creative tools to create fun, engaging short videos on Instagram. Record and edit 15-second multi-clip Reels videos with audio, text, special effects and stickers, then share them with your followers.
Instagram Story videos overlap with Instagram Reels in many ways. The company has added various functions to smooth out the differences between the two.
Content Creation Tools
Since the Instagram Stories feature has been around for a while, you’ll find better and feature-rich options for creating the perfect story. Instagram Reels is the relatively new kid around the block. While the company has added the most relevant features for Reels, it’s nowhere near Story for content creation.
Below are the main tools for creating a beautiful looking Instagram Story.
Text: You can add text to your Instagram Story with loads of gradient backgrounds.
Boomerang: With Boomerang, you can create captivating mini-videos that bounce back and forth and then share them with your friends.
Order: As the name suggests, Instagram Layout lets you fit up to 6 photos in a single Story. You can choose from a range of frame sizes and shapes.

Super zoom: It allows you to zoom the content using various effects such as Superzoom, Heart, Fire, Dramatic, Beat. It is popular among the younger generation.

Hands free: The new hands-free feature allows you to record video with a single tap.
On top of that, you can always add loads of effects, stickers, doodles, and even add fancy fonts, text with space and time to the Story.

The reels feel more engaging, lively and fun with the music and playback speed. Unlike Story, Reels is all about using the perfect music with matching video and creating Reels with effects and stickers. Take a look at all the Reel features and you’ll see how it’s more geared towards different creators.
Music: Music is an essential part of making a remarkable Reel. Instagram offers tons of ready-made music clips to choose from.

Set Recording Speed: Many users will love it. You can slow down the video by 5x or speed up the Reel by 3x. It’s different from Story Boomerang.
Effects: Effects are the heart of the Instagram experience. You can add Stupid face, Party Lights, Green Screen according to your mood and choose from dozens of other effects for a perfect Instagram Reel.

Video Duration: Instagram Reels allow us to create videos of up to 15 seconds. But it is not necessary to stretch the video to 15 seconds each time. You can also create a 5 second or 10 second video.
Add Timer: This is something that Instagram Story is missing. You can set a three-second timer to capture the right moments at the right time.
Align Captured Video: If the captured video is shaky or blurry, you can use the Align option to correct the situation.

Looking at the list of features, you can see that the Instagram Story tools are more geared towards improving the final image. Instagram Reels features aim to create a nice and attractive video.
Experience Sharing
There is a notable difference when it comes to sharing an Instagram Story and a Reel. With Story, you can share it among your followers via direct message or publish it on your profile. However, the Instagram story is not added to your feed. And it will disappear after 24 hours.

You can share Instagram Reels anywhere. Instagram allows you to share Reels as Stories, use Direct Message to send to followers and even post to your feed. You’ll also find a dedicated Reels tab in the Explore menu.
In short, Instagram Reels has a chance to reach a wider audience than Story.
Story or Reels: Your Choice
It all depends on the type of content you create for followers. Stories are a more personal way to share memories with friends and family. Reels take the experience even further with music, playback and other options. Marketers, publishers and influencers will love it. What about you?
